General Installation Guide for Weichai 24V Alternator
Pre-installation Preparation and Safety Specifications
Vehicle Preparation
Turn off the engine, engage the handbrake, and shift the gearbox to P (Park)/N (Neutral).
Perform all operations on a cooled engine and keep away from high-temperature/rotating components.
Disconnect the main power switch or the negative terminals of dual batteries, wrap the connectors with insulating material, and strictly prohibit live operation on alternator terminals throughout the process.
Tools and Consumables
Tools: Socket/wrench (sizes: 10/13/14/17/19/22 mm), torque wrench, special belt tensioner tool, brush/cleaning agent.
Consumables: Copper paste/petroleum jelly, insulating tape, cable ties, lock washers, new belt (if necessary).
Spare Part and Space Confirmation
Verify that the alternator model matches the vehicle's model and production year; check for intact appearance and ensure bearings and slip rings rotate smoothly without jamming.
Confirm terminal markings (B+/BAT for main power supply, S/IGN for control wire, housing for grounding).
Remove obstructive components such as the air filter box and protective covers; take photos to record the installation position of the old alternator and wiring harness routing for easy reassembly.
Step-by-Step Installation Process (Reverse of Disassembly Sequence)

Fastening Mounting Bolts
First, screw in all fixing bolts by hand.
Then use a torque wrench to tighten them diagonally and in stages.
Reference Torque: 45–60 N·m for mounting bolts, 12–18 N·m for terminal nuts (refer to the official manual for exact values).
Avoid over-tightening to prevent housing deformation, and avoid under-tightening to prevent resonance and abnormal noise.
Electrical Connection (Core Sequence: Control Circuit First, Power Circuit Second; Thin Wires First, Thick Wires Second)
Control Wire (S/IGN): Fully insert the plug or tighten the small nut to ensure a secure connection without loosening or poor contact, which could otherwise cause voltage regulation abnormalities.
Main Power Wire (B+/BAT): Connect the thick positive battery cable, tighten it with a lock washer. Apply copper paste or petroleum jelly to the terminal surface to prevent oxidation and ablation.
Grounding: The alternator is naturally grounded to the engine block via mounting bolts—ensure the contact surface is free of paint and rust. For models equipped with an independent grounding wire, fasten the wire securely in addition to avoid voltage instability, overheating and regulator burnout.
Belt Installation and Tension Adjustment
Route the belt strictly according to the diagram in the engine compartment; never misroute or reverse the belt. For alternators with a one-way pulley, confirm the correct rotation direction.
Use a belt tensioner tool to release tension, fit the belt onto the alternator pulley, then release the tool. Press the middle section of the belt—the deflection should be controlled within 10–15 mm (refer to the official manual for exact values).
Excessive tension will accelerate bearing wear; insufficient tension will cause belt slippage and abnormal noise.
Power Restoration, Testing and Reassembly
Check that the wiring harness has no interference or insulation damage, secure it with cable ties, then reconnect the negative battery terminals or close the main power switch.
Idle Test: Start the engine—the alternator should run smoothly without abnormal noise, and the belt should show no signs of slippage. The dashboard charging indicator light should turn off, and the voltage should stabilize at 27.5–28.5 V.
Load Test: Turn on high-power electrical loads such as headlights and air conditioning—the voltage should remain stable at 27.0–28.5 V without significant drop.
Refit all removed components and clean up the work area and tools.
Key Precautions for Installation of Weichai 24V Internally Regulated Alternator
Power-off Operation Must Be Implemented Throughout the Entire Process
Prior to installation, disconnect the vehicle's main power switch or the negative terminals of dual batteries, and wrap the connectors with insulating tape to prevent accidental power-on.
Live operation on alternator terminals is strictly prohibited throughout the process to avoid arc burns, coil burnout or voltage regulator damage.
Before restoring power supply, recheck that all wiring connections are free of loosening and short-circuit risks.
Cleanliness of Mounting Surface and Control of Positioning Accuracy
Thoroughly remove oil stains, rust and impurities from the joint surface between the engine mounting bracket and the alternator housing. Residual foreign objects will lead to excessive mounting clearance, resulting in abnormal operation noise, bolt loosening and even shortened bearing service life.
Align the mounting holes accurately during positioning. Never strike the alternator housing forcibly; otherwise, the internal rotor, stator coils and bearings will be damaged, rendering the alternator completely unusable.
Bolt Fastening Must Strictly Comply with Torque Standards
Both the mounting bolts and terminal nuts must be tightened with a torque wrench. Reference torque: 45–60 N·m for mounting bolts, 12–18 N·m for terminal nuts (refer to the official Weichai service manual for the specific vehicle model for exact values).
Adopt the diagonal and staged tightening method to ensure uniform force distribution. Over-tightening will cause housing deformation and bearing jamming; under-tightening will induce resonance and abnormal noise, and in extreme cases, bolt detachment may damage surrounding engine compartment components.

Electrical Connection Must Follow the Irreversible Sequence
Wiring sequence: Connect the control circuit (S/IGN terminal, thin wire) first, then the main power circuit (B+/BAT terminal, thick wire). Reverse the sequence during disassembly to prevent high-current short circuits that could burn out fuses or the alternator.
A lock washer must be installed at the main power wire connector. After tightening, apply copper paste or petroleum jelly to the terminal surface to prevent oxidation and ablation.
Fully insert the control circuit plug or tighten the small nut to avoid loosening and poor contact, which would otherwise cause voltage regulation abnormalities, no power generation or persistent illumination of the charging indicator light.
Guarantee grounding reliability: The alternator is naturally grounded to the engine block through mounting bolts—ensure the contact surface is free of paint and rust. For models equipped with an independent grounding wire, fasten the grounding wire connector securely in addition. Poor grounding will lead to unstable generating voltage, alternator overheating and even regulator burnout.
